Transaction 43d357e141b93240a171fffc1ea77ea277f8a837043c74dbe557e0eff90fddf3
1 Input
2 Outputs
- 43d357e141b93240a171fffc1ea77ea277f8a837043c74dbe557e0eff90fddf3:0
- 43d357e141b93240a171fffc1ea77ea277f8a837043c74dbe557e0eff90fddf3:1
value 1356
address 18oSsgmcN8b9FcYSCMff5rg8NKySSvvJpm
value 24771
address 1F2dsxref3dnLerd14HktLUb6jNNweGAcu